Here are three (3) shifts to explore for raising your pricing:

  1. Be a Solution Provider vs. Service Provider Are you framing your offer as a solution, instead of a service? Reframe how you're positioning your offer.

  2. Be Confident to Request You won't know without requesting the price for your program. Have you clearly articulated the solution? Clients are available at every price point and need your work. Don’t fear “no” as always feedback on how you are communicating the value.

  3. It's a Value Add to Charge More For Your Clients It’s not about you, it’s about them getting the results. You'll receive a higher commitment from clients to show up and do the work, create the results, and follow your process.
